All offences · Oct 2024 - Sep 2025Burrington Way area has the 43rd lowest crime rate of 85 local areas in Ham , and the 371st highest crime rate of 839 local areas in Plymouth .
At least one of the neighbouring streets has high or very high crime levels. However, overall crime around this postcode is more mixed, with some nearby areas experiencing lower crime.
The overall crime rate in the area around Burrington Way (PL5 3LR) in the last 12 months was 78.8 per 1,000 residents and was 8.1% lower than the Ham average (85.7 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 12 offences recorded. The least common crime was Criminal damage and arson with 1 case , unchanged from 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Other crime ( 100.0% YoY). Other major crime categories were broadly unchanged compared to 2024.
Violent crimes totalled 14 (≈ 42.4 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 75.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-66.2%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Burrington Way (PL5 3LR),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Burrington Way, where police recorded 11 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Malmesbury Close (5 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
